Xiaomi Mi Mix Alpha has an overall score of 88.9, which is much better than the Motorola Moto G9 Plus's global score of 80.5. Despite being the best phone we compare here, Xiaomi Mi Mix Alpha's construction is older, just a bit heavier and just a little bit thicker than the Motorola Moto G9 Plus. Both of these phones work with the same Android 10 OS (Operating System).
The Xiaomi Mi Mix Alpha counts with a little better performance than Motorola Moto G9 Plus, and although they both have the same number of cores, the Xiaomi Mi Mix Alpha also has a higher amount of RAM memory. Xiaomi Mi Mix Alpha features a bit more vivid screen than Motorola Moto G9 Plus, because it has a higher resolution of 2088 x 2250 pixels, a quite higher number of pixels in each inch in the screen and a larger display.
Xiaomi Mi Mix Alpha has much more memory for apps and games than Moto G9 Plus, because although it has no SD extension slot, it also counts with 512 GB internal storage capacity. The Motorola Moto G9 Plus has longer battery life than Xiaomi Mi Mix Alpha, because it has a 5000mAh battery size.
